BASSEY TURNS STANDARDS INTO CLASSICS~BRAVO SHIRLEY!!!
Bradly Briggs | TOLUCA LAKE, CALIFORNIA | 06/02/2004
(5 out of 5 stars)

"When a great set of songs like these are put together by a GREAT singer like Shirley Bassey, you know your in store for a special treat and that is what this great collection is!! Beginning with early to mid-sixties standards such as a jazz tinged exciting rendition of "I Believe In You", it is clear that this is a classic singer with an incredibly great voice in peak form!! "Fool On The Hill" is soulfully sung and "The Look Of Love" is sultry while "And I Love You So" is haunting and mesmerizing. The exhuberant "Day By Day" is winning and "Send In The Clowns" is one of the most beautifully sung versions ever!! Beginning with the seventies material, one can notice that Shirley's voice became fuller and more powerful and Miss Bassey uses her full bloom voice to stunning effect on classics such as "Killing Me Softly With His Song" and "Feelings" in this engrossing collection. Too bad Shirley Bassey didn't star in "Evita" as her "Don't Cry For Me Argentina" is the definitive version which has never sounded as passionate and beautiful as it does here!!! BRAVO SHIRLEY...a true classic Diva with an extraordinary voice...enjoy!!!!!!!!"
